In the context of Korean internet slang and content creation, a "BJ" stands for Broadcasting Jockey—a term coined primarily by the pioneer platform AfreecaTV (now SOOP) to describe independent live streamers. When viewers search for "neat" Korean BJ content, they are typically referring to highly organized, professional, and visually structured streams that focus on clean aesthetics, minimal clutter, and distinct content categories like Mukbang, ASMR, talk shows, and gaming.

Stepfamily Ministry: Because Marriage Ministry is NOT Enough.
Many people are surprised to hear us make the above statement, but over a decade of specializing in stepfamily ministry has taught us that it is the truth: typical marriage education programs and ministries are not sufficient for couples in stepfamilies. Since marriage in a stepfamily is a "package deal" you must minister to both the couple and "the package." This means addressing dynamics related to ex-spouses and co-parenting, loss, stepparenting, spiritual shame, finances, and the expectations of both children and adults--just to name a few. To do anything less is grossly inadequate to prevent divorce.
